Mithali Raj tops ICC ranking, but the Indian media has little interest in women’s cricket

By Sudatta Mukherjee 

 

On February 28, 2012, when Virat Kohli scored an unbeaten 133 to guide India to a seven-wicket victory over Sri Lanka in a do-or-die match, the Indian media went on an overdrive in burying him with adjectives. But when another Indian cricketer got to the top of the ICC ODI rankings for batsmen, there was hardly a ripple in the media. Why? The answer is simple: The player in question is Mithali Raj and the ICC rankings are for women’s cricket.
